What if all the women around the globe Disappearrrr….

 

Yes, you heard me right.

 

If “All the women disappear” how would the world look?

 

Would all the “so called Islamic fitna vanish”? and our beloved men would go straight to Jannah.

 

Would the world be a better place? or I’d say a worst place to live — emotionless.

 

Let's analyse how the world would work without us.

 

There would be no cosmetics and hence the cosmetic industry would collapse. There would be no jewellery and hence the industry would be gone.

Multiple shampoo brands would no more exists since men use 3 in 1 shampoo (shampoo + conditioner + body wash)

 

Light girly colours would be replaced by dull neutral tones (beige, slate grey chocolate brown plum etc). Also, the clothing industry would be cut to half.

 

The shoe factory would reduce to half or may be even more since the male shoes are a handful of the variety.

 

Moreover, the medical, education and pharmaceutical industry would face a major decline since there would be no beauty issues which need some medicines, the gyne profession would fade out and so do the gender biased studies. Also, 80% of the healthcare sector are female so we can say that there would be no more care of the patients. 

 

There would be no more children and so the children's product industry would face major decline. The child care sector would not be needed anymore.

 

The education field has 76% women and hence there would be no more education and men would eventually go to cave age… Ha Ha Ha

 

The saloons would go off for both men and women as there would be no one to be groomed for and hence the beauty products would go extinct. Also, there would be no liveliness. The world would seem boring and dry with lazy men all around having no competition hence Hakuna Matata.

 

The media industry would be out of scripts and stories for the screen and hence would face a sharp spike.

 

The most important thing, kitchen and its industry (cookware, spices, and other related items), all would be reduced to one half if only men would be looking into the kitchen affairs. Men would be cooking the same dish again and again or would go for processed food leaving behind the rest of the opportunities.

  

In short, the world would be a total mess without women as Iqbal stated:

 

Of the universe’s painting, woman’s existence is the colour

 

Well, that was all on a lighter note. The world has been created in a smooth order and it is well-maintained with both men and women. Where women are nurturing the emotional side of the society, men are bound to develop the visionary colours of the world. The world comprises 49% of women and have vital existential reasons like to continue the human race, create balance, and do jobs that men couldn’t do.
